Jackie Swann, North Carolina State Bureau of Investigation, is a dedicated officer, unfazed by the dangers of her chosen profession. She is also a wife and mother, immersed in the struggle between career and family life. Her latest assignment will test her marriage and risk far more than her life.
Dallas Reid, Phoenix City Police Department, is a bit of a rogue cop, accustomed to doing whatever must be done to bring criminals to justice. Drug dealers are his specialty. But he's beginning to wonder if there isn't more to life than busting bad boys.
Phoenix City, North Carolina, like many small and large cities, has a drug problem. Like many cities, it is the scene of battles between rival drug gangs. But the current spate of violence has Dallas Reid baffled.
All along the city's strip of bars and clubs, people are disappearing. Local pushers are being replaced by mindless giants who negotiate drug sales in chilling whispers. And Dal's usually reliable network of informers has dried up. There are plenty of rumors about the new gang in town, but precious few facts.
Sent in by the SBI, Jackie Swann reports that a gang of Haitians is trying to take over the drug trade throughout the state, with Phoenix City as the first step. Their tactics are psychological intimidation, physical force, and something unnatural and evil - all orchestrated by a mysterious figure known only as the "boneman."
What Dallas Reid and Jackie Swann experience as they investigate the boneman will challenge everything they believe about themselves, about justice and mercy, about good and evil.
